Bossa Nova Concert on Sunday January 12 at 3pm

Arts & Culture

Love and Bossa Nova International Brazilian music star Daniela Soledade and virtuoso guitarist Nate Najar transport you to tropical Rio de Janeiro, Brazil with an intimate program of Bossa Nova music.  The concert will include numbers by composers Antonio Carlos Jobim, Cole Porter and Ary Barroso, all enhanced by the excellent acoustics of the Peace sanctuary. Daniela Soledade is highly acclaimed for her poignantly expressive vocal style and hyper-intimate aesthetic. Nate Najar is one of this decade’s finest modern jazz guitarists and together they create a musical environment that is lush, delicate, and simply superb. No tickets needed.  Seating is first come, first served.  Donations to help defray future performance costs are requested ($5-$10 minimum suggested donation). Doors open at 2:30. 

Peace Memorial Presb. Church (the pink church downtown) 110 S. Ft. Harrison Ave., Clwr. (corner of Pierce and Ft. Harrison), Clearwater .
